Warning Signs You Need Commercial Water Extraction
Don’t ignore these warning signs of water damage – they can save you money and prevent bigger problems down the road. Our team is here to help you identify and address the issue before it’s too late.
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Strong, unpleasant odors can show the presence of mold and mildew. If you notice a persistent musty smell in your office building or home, it’s time to call us for a thorough inspection and extraction.
Water Stains on the Ceiling or Walls
Water stains can be a sign of a bigger problem, such as a leaky roof or burst pipe. If you notice water stains on your ceiling or walls, don’t delay – call us for a prompt response and expert extraction.
Warped or Buckled Flooring
Warped or buckled flooring can show water damage beneath the surface. If you notice any unusual changes in your flooring, it’s time to call us for a thorough inspection and extraction.
Peeling Paint or Wallpaper
Peeling paint or wallpaper can be a sign of water damage or high humidity. If you notice any unusual changes in your walls or ceilings, don’t delay – call us for a prompt response and expert extraction.
Unusual Sounds or Leaks
Unusual sounds or leaks can show a bigger problem, such as a burst pipe or overflowing toilet. If you notice any unusual sounds or leaks, don’t delay – call us for a prompt response and expert extraction.
Visible Water Damage or Leaks
Visible water damage or leaks can be a sign of a bigger problem. If you notice any water damage or leaks, don’t delay – call us for a prompt response and expert extraction.
Commercial Water Extraction v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small, contained leak | Yes | No | DIY is usually enough for small, contained leaks. |
| Burst pipe or flooding | No | Yes | A burst pipe or flooding needs a prompt and professional response to reduce damage. |
| Water damage in a high-value area | No | Yes | Water damage in high-value areas, such as a data center or server room, needs a professional response to reduce downtime and prevent data loss. |
| Hidden water damage or moisture | No | Yes | Hidden water damage or moisture can be difficult to detect and need specialized equipment to identify and extract. |
| Water damage in a sensitive or historical building | No | Yes | Water damage in sensitive or historical buildings needs a professional response to prevent damage to irreplaceable materials and ensure a thorough and gentle restoration process. |
| Water damage with mold or mildew present | No | Yes | Water damage with mold or mildew present needs a professional response to prevent the growth of these microorganisms and ensure a safe and healthy environment. |

Commercial Water Extraction Cost in Lake Stevens, WA
The cost of commercial water extraction can vary depending on the severity and size of the affected area, as well as local conditions in Lake Stevens, WA. Our estimates are free and based on a thorough assessment of your property. We’ll work with you to create a customized plan that fits your budget and meets your needs.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Emergency Response | $500 – $2,500 | Severity of damage, size of affected area, and local conditions |
| Water Extraction |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area, type of equipment needed, and labor costs |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area, type of equipment needed, and labor costs |
| Cleaning and Disinfecting |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area, type of materials involved, and labor costs |
| Restoration and Reconstruction | $2,000 – $10,000 | Size of affected area, type of materials involved, and labor costs |
| Equipment Rental and Labor |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area, type of equipment needed, and labor costs |
Exact pricing depends on an on-site assessment and a thorough evaluation of your property. We offer free estimates and work with you to create a customized plan that fits your budget and meets your needs.
